Output 51d794d7de4a43283017efbfaaa4a2727648990ab06f6dd4b65a85b65376dfb0:1

value
11153869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19f45e63ca86cb6f740ad397d1d7de0ae878c183 OP_EQUAL
address
344FZNiJ3ymXxJmvDBJ13erGEqpBzgxhRH
transaction
51d794d7de4a43283017efbfaaa4a2727648990ab06f6dd4b65a85b65376dfb0
spent
true